Emmanuel Colombier Appointed as Managing Director and Vice Chairman, ALSTOM Projects India Limited

New Delhi, Delhi, India

Alstom today announced the appointment of Emmanuel Colombier as Managing Director & Vice Chairman, ALSTOM Projects India Limited (APIL) to be based in Gurgaon, India. Colombier takes over from Frederic Lalanne.

Colombier 46, holds a degree in marine engineering and has been with Alstom for the past 18 years, leading various positions in Sales, Project Management and General Management within the Power Sector in France and abroad. Prior to this appointment, Colombier was the Area Manager for Europe & Central Asia at Alstom International Network in Paris, France, Alstom's Corporate Headquarters. This will be Emmanuel's second stint in India.

Colombier has had a three-year stint in Bangalore from 1997- 99 where he was the Managing Director of Alstom Steam Turbines India Ltd.

About ALSTOM Projects India Limited (APIL)

ALSTOM Projects India Ltd (APIL) is a majority owned subsidiary company of Alstom SA France - the global leader in power generation and rail infrastructure and a multinational company that nurtures a long-term commitment to India. The company provides various power generation systems, equipment, and services, including turbo machines, boilers, environmental control systems, heat recovery steam generators, energy recovery systems, and hydro power turbines and generators. It also offers a range of power generation services and equipment, from repair, performance improvement, lifetime extension services, and on-site field services to full-operation and maintenance solutions.

ALSTOM Projects India Ltd (APIL) offers a composite range of services for transportation systems covering traction, signaling and train control for the railways and energy management for a variety of industries.

In India since 1910, Alstom is one of the oldest foreign companies in the country employing over 3000 people across its six engineering centres, a software technology facility at Bangalore, four manufacturing units (Hydro in Vadodara, Boilers in Durgapur & Shahabad and Transport in Coimbatore) and has sales offices in Mumbai Gurgaon and Kolkata. ALSTOM Projects India Ltd. has a turnover of Rs 1250 crore and is listed at BSE and NSE with 33 per cent of its equity with the public.
